Air Force Releases First-Term Airman Retraining Quotas for FY18
JULY 12, 2017, JOINT BASE SAN ANTONIO-RANDOLPH (AFNS) - Eligible active-duty first-term Airmen may choose from more than 1,400 approved retraining quotas in over 20 career fields for fiscal year 2018.
